One main question about turn order after starting our first campaign.

We have 2 heroes. To start a game we have one rebel hero choose to go first (Rebel A) and we resolve as follows.

Round 1:

Rebel A (1)

Imp.

Rebel B (1)

Imp.

​Must be Rebel A (2)

Imp.

Rebel B (2)

Imp.

Round 2:

Must be Rebel A (1)

and so on...

Is this too rigid? In other words, does it have to be A,B,A,B or can it be A,B,B,A? Also, please address if each round has to start with the same rebel.

I haven't played any game with less than 4 heroes, but as I remember it, each hero has to go once before one can go a second time. However, which one goes first (and 3rd) can change round to round.

Actually had this fight with my players.

Rules as written (all one sentence on the subject tucked away in the "learn to play book") simply states that all players must go once before anyone goes twice. *So, either player may take their second turn after, even if they are going twice.

I *prefer alternating turns, but that's my opinion. I think the flexibility gives the rebels even *more advantage.

There is no rule restricting which rebel has to go first each round. Yes, that means the rebels can time it out ABBA ABBA, to constantly get back to back activations and turbosprint around the map.

Moral of the story? The "less than four rebels" rules are less than perfect. If your players are organizationally capable of handling more than one rebel hero, play with four heroes (more than one per person). That's my suggestion, having played both ways.
